Overview
A Hardwick Colliery Company pit at Heath Common near Chesterfield, whose shafts had to be driven through a two-mile basin of water left by older workings and were lined with nineteen-foot iron tubbing to hold it back. Completed in 1905 after four years of sinking, it was said to be the deepest colliery in the Midlands, took the output of neighbouring Grassmoor and Holmewood underground, and closed on 28 March 1970. The shafts still pump water for the whole district and the settling ponds are now a nature reserve.
History
The Wingerworth and Hardwick Colliery Company set out to establish a new first-class colliery at Williamthorpe capable of raising four thousand tons of coal a day, the terms of Mrs Hunloke's lease requiring shafts to the Blackshale seam. Sinking began in 1901 and immediately ran into water: the shafts were being put down into a basin two miles across, flooded from the abandoned workings of the old Lings colliery, and in two years only 180 of the 550 yards had been achieved. The answer was to line the shaft with cast-iron tubbing nineteen feet in diameter. Although the ground yielded two and a half tons of water a minute at six to seven hundred pounds to the square inch, the plates held, and the shaft was watertight through the whole depth of the flooded strata. It was finished in 1905 and the colliery was then reckoned the deepest in the Midlands. Its cages had three decks, carrying twelve trams or seven tons of coal in a wind of forty-five seconds, worked by steam engines from Markham and Company of Chesterfield with forty-two-inch cylinders and a seven-foot stroke. The underground roadways from Holmewood were deliberately driven downhill into the Williamthorpe pit bottom so that coal would run in by gravity rather than by powered haulage. The village of Holmewood was built by the company to house the men. The colliery employed about 1,550 across its two pits in 1923 and again in 1933, dropped to under 1,150 by 1940, and had 998 men in 1947, when it raised 361,000 tons of coking, gas, household, manufacturing and steam coal. Under the National Coal Board it was steadily mechanised: an arc shearer for headings and a Joy loader in 1951, a training centre in 1952, the last horses withdrawn from underground in 1954, a Gloster getter in 1955, pithead baths in 1958, a Huwood power loader and a new Sirocco fan late on. A brickworks on the site was at one time turning out five million bricks a year, and a Tromp washing plant treated the coal. Manpower peaked at 2,767 in 1958. By 1963 the pit had been reorganised underground with a modern coal preparation plant, and it took the output of Grassmoor, sunk in 1875-78, to the surface at Williamthorpe; two thousand men across the combined operation were raising over 800,000 tons a year from the Deep Soft, Ell, First and Second Waterloo and Second Piper seams, virtually all of it machine-won. Williamthorpe and Holmewood were merged under one manager in 1967 and a record 5,430 tons was turned in twenty-four hours. Output reached 1,006,079 tons in 1968-69, the pit's second million-ton year. Water remained the theme to the end: an inrush came from the old Avenue colliery workings when it erupted through the floor of the Second Piper, hampering production until pumping was restored at Avenue No. 9 shaft. In 1969, 150 men over sixty were pushed into early retirement out of a workforce of 1,780, and the colliery closed on 28 March 1970 after sixty-five years, the cost of deep-seam working having told against it.
Geology
The lease required shafts to the Blackshale, the deep seam at the base of the productive Coal Measures here, and the pit worked upward and outward from it: the Tupton into the 1960s, the Blackshale or Silkstone to 1969, and in its reorganised years the Deep Soft, Ell, First and Second Waterloo and Second Piper. The defining geological problem was not the coal but the water: the shafts went down inside a basin some two miles across flooded from the abandoned Lings workings, and the Second Piper workings were later invaded by water erupting through the floor from the old Avenue colliery below.

Workings
Two shafts completed in 1905, lined through the flooded strata with cast-iron tubbing nineteen feet in diameter, with triple-deck cages taking twelve trams or seven tons at a wind and steam winders by Markham and Company of Chesterfield. Roadways from Holmewood were driven downhill into the pit bottom so that coal ran in by gravity, and there were underground connections to both Holmewood and Grassmoor. On the surface were a Tromp coal washing plant, a brickworks making up to five million bricks a year, an aerial ropeway and, from 1958, pithead baths.
Closure
Closed on 28 March 1970 after sixty-five years, the high cost of deep-seam mining having told against it; the closure caused heavy unemployment in Holmewood, the village the company had built for the workforce. Pumping was discontinued at closure and the shafts kept open to monitor the expected rise in water, but the site was later brought back into use as a mine-water pumping station and remains one.
What remains
The colliery is gone but the shafts are not. Williamthorpe is a remote mine-water pumping station standing in a compound inside a large industrial estate on Tupton Way off Park Road, Holmewood; part of the original heapstead survives, No. 1 shaft is capped with steel and pipes emerge from it, and No. 2 has a concrete head with an inspection cover suggesting it is still unfilled. Water pumped from the shaft settles in the Williamthorpe pools, where its metal content drops out before the water reaches the watercourse, and those pools are now the Williamthorpe Ponds nature reserve on the Five Pits Trail.

Related mines
- Avenue Colliery — Water erupted from the floor of Williamthorpe's Second Piper seam out of these abandoned workings below it, hampering production until pumping was restored at Avenue No. 9 shaft.
- Grassmoor Colliery — From August 1950 Grassmoor stopped winding its own coal, which went by conveyor to the Williamthorpe pit bottom and was raised there; Grassmoor's shafts were kept open as Williamthorpe's second means of egress.
- Holmewood Colliery — Connected underground, the Holmewood roadways being driven downhill into the Williamthorpe pit bottom so that coal ran in by gravity; the two collieries were merged under one manager in 1967.
